Abstrakt

en

The COVID-19 pandemic has significantly affected the transport industry functioning. Changes in the volume of transported cargo were observed in particular transport modes, and above all in ports transshipments. The aim of the article is to investigate the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ic on the selected stevedore companies functioning in seaports during the initial stage of the pandemic. Selected companies operating in Polish and Ukrainian seaports were analyzed as a case study. The condition of chosen transshipment terminals was examined during the first four months from announcement of pandemic in these countries. Survey method was used to conduct the research. On the basis of the prepared questionnaire, the survey was conducted among representatives of cargo transshipment terminals and the impact of the pandemic on the functioning of stevedore companies was examined. It was found that all companies had to introduce changes to the organization of terminal’s operation. However, the impact on the volume of cargo transshipments, ships service and cargo handling was varied. The article presents preliminary research results that will be continued in the future.
